In January 2017, there were 31 homes sold, with a median sale price of $375,000 - a 26.5% increase over the $296,500 median sale price for the same period of the previous year. There were 28 homes sold in Bridgeport in January 2016.
The median sales tax in Bridgeport for 2017 was $5,097. In 2016, the median sales tax was $4,860. This marks an increase of 4.9%. The effective property tax rate, using the median property tax and median home sale price as the basis, is 1.4%.
